The Impact of Water Damage on Phone Value
Water damage is one of the leading causes of smartphone malfunction, contributing to significant financial loss for users. When a phone incurs moisture, several components may be affected, including the screen, battery, motherboard, and internal circuitry. Understanding the implications of this damage is crucial for determining resale value:
- Functional Impairment: A water-damaged phone may still operate but exhibit issues like battery drainage, screen flickering, or connectivity problems. Each defect further depresses its market value.
- Repairability: Phones that can be repaired (such as those with replaceable parts) may retain higher value than those with extensive internal damage. Buyers assess repair costs against potential resale profits.
- Model Popularity: High-demand models may still fetch a reasonable price, even when damaged, compared to older or less popular devices. Supply and demand dynamics largely define market rates for such phones.
Evaluating Your Phone’s Condition
Before seeking cash for your water-damaged phone, conduct a thorough evaluation of its condition. Here are the steps to effectively assess your device:
- Visual Inspection: Check for visible signs of water damage, such as corrosion around ports or water spots on the screen. Remove the SIM and memory cards for a complete look.
- Functionality Test: Turn on your phone if possible and test basic functions including charging, camera, touchscreen responsiveness, and audio quality. Document any issues.
- Check Internal Indicators: Many smartphones have liquid contact indicators that change color when exposed to moisture. Locate these indicators to determine severity.
A comprehensive evaluation will aid in setting realistic expectations regarding potential cash offers.
Factors Affecting Cash Offers
Various elements influence cash offers for water-damaged phones, including:
- Extent of Damage: The degree of water damage directly impacts the value. Minimal damage often yields better cash offers.
- Phone Model and Age: Newer and high-value models generally attract better offers, regardless of condition.
- Market Demand: A competitive market increases cash offers, while decreased demand for specific models may result in lower valuations.
- Potential for Repair: Phones that can be easily repaired tend to hold more value, as buyers envision potential profit margins.

Comparing Online and Local Options
When deciding between online and local selling options, consider the following:
- Convenience: Online platforms often allow you to list your phone quickly and receive offers without leaving home. Local options may require travel.
- Offer Comparison: Online selling often provides multiple offers from various buyers, while local shops typically offer a single cash value.
- Market Reach: Online marketplaces can reach a more extensive buyer network, possibly generating a higher cash offer.
- Transaction Speed: Local shops may provide immediate cash, while online sales may require shipping and waiting for payment.
